Introduction:
Welcome to the inaugural in-person event of the “Gen AI in Fintech” meetup: “GenAI in Fintech Product Innovation”.
Gen AI in Fintech is dedicated to discussing and sharing the latest trends, best practices, use cases, and regulatory considerations for Gen AI applications in fintech in Australia and globally.
Key takeaways:
- GenAI product innovation's current key use cases in Fintech industry.
- Key challenges, successes and learnings with GenAI product innovation's adoption within Fintech industry.
- RAG as a Service in GenAI product innovation in Fintech industry.
- The importance of data governance in GenAI product innovation in Fintech industry.
- Data governance framework in GenAI product innovation in Fintech industry.
